WBIL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2022 in Review
12 of the 6,341 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in WBI BullBear Quality 3000 ETF (WBIL) for Q1 2022, worth a combined $37.7M — down 3.9% from $39.2M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 2 funds opened new WBIL positions and 0 closed out — a net gain of 2 holders — while 3 added to existing stakes and 5 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Jane Street, opening a new position worth an estimated $515K. The largest seller was LPL Financial, cutting an estimated $1.89M.
